Objectives

To design a generative art piece or a game exploring in depth one  of the generative methods discussed in this course.

Description

For the last 3 weeks you have been working on your final project: a generative art piece or a game that uses procedural content generation. All this work will be delivered as both a web page in your portfolio and a Google Slides deck. The page will contain all the documentation of your project and the slide deck will be used to present the project in class. The project will be presented on August 15 (Thursday) in 7 minutes (5 for content, 1 for demo and  1 for questions):

  • Web Page
    • The name of your experience.
    • Your name and contact info (email, twitter, etc) .
    • A playable canvas (if you used p5.js or other WebGL based engine) or an image link  to download the binary of your piece (if you used a non WebGL engine). If you have an image link, it should be a screenshot from your experience.
      • 1-2 paragraphs describing what is this experience about and how to interact with it.
      • An "About " link that points to your Project Proposal page.
      • A "Source Code" link that points to your Project's GitHub repo.
    • Slide Deck
      • Cover (1 Slide)
      • Artistic Statement (from Proposal) : 1-2 slides
      • A description of the experience itself (from Proposal): 1-3 slides
        • Technical details (from Proposal): 1-3 slides
        • Schedule (from Proposal): 1-2 slides
        • Demo (link to your project's web page): 1 slide

      Submission

      Your submission will be two links: one to your project webpage and another one to your Google Slides.
